Crime overview

Babbacombe Road area has the 67th lowest crime rate of 165 local areas in Bickley & Sundridge , and the 406th lowest crime rate of 928 local areas in Bromley .

This postcode forms a relatively safe pocket compared with the surrounding streets. Neighbouring areas record much higher crime levels, even though this postcode itself remains comparatively low-crime.

The overall crime rate in the area around Babbacombe Road (BR1 3LS) in the last 12 months was 44.9 per 1,000 residents and was 19.3% lower than the Bickley & Sundridge average (55.6 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Vehicle crime with 7 offences recorded. The least common crime was Other crime with 1 case , up 100.0% compared to 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Vehicle crime ( 133.3% YoY). Other major crime categories were broadly unchanged compared to 2025.

Violent crimes totalled 4 (≈ 12.8 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were rising ( 33.3%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-66.2%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Babbacombe Road (BR1 3LS), the main crime hotspot is near Station Road. Police recorded 22 crimes here, including 15 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
